Splice[1] Studio[2] used to be version control for music software (from about 2013-2021). You could browse Ableton Live (and a few other DAWs) projects and see the tracks and rendered versions each time you saved, add metadata etc. They pivoted into the more profitable sample discovery and sales business later and dropped the less profitable studio product.
